Hi all, this is a nice change from the doner kebab. Oil optional & sugar substituted for sweetener, serves 1-2 depending on size of chicken breast.

2 tbsp veg oil (optional or reduce qty)
2 tbsp lemon juice
1/4 tsp paprika
1/4 tsp Ginger powder
1/4 tsp garlic powder
1/4 tsp cumin powder
1/4 tsp Garam masala
1/4 tsp sweetener (increase if needed)
Small handful fresh coriander, finely chopped
Generous Pinch salt & black pepper
1- 2 large skinless chicken breasts
1 onion, 1 pepper chopped into large pieces
Pitta (either syn or HEB depending where bought)

Cut chicken into small thin strips.
Mix all ingredients together well in a bowl.
Marinade chicken for 4 hrs, preferably overnight.
Preheat oven to 200C/ 400F/gas mark 6
Arrange chicken on wire rack over baking tray & bake for 8 mins, turn & bake for another 8 mins. Turn once more and bake for 2-3 mins or until just beginning to char.
Dry fry onions & peppers, stir fry 5-6 mins.
Serve chicken, onion & peppers in a pitta salad.
